Alters, temples, and royal tombs had cities built around them
Believed in the spirit world, used a "dragon bone" (oracle bone) to tell inscriptions of the weather, luck of the king, natural disasters, and good times to start projects
Sacrifices to the gods were believed to keep the gods happy, sacrificed dogs, humans, and horses as well as food offerings inside a bronze vessel called the Fang Ding Zun
